A child's play vanity built from two little 1x12 nightstand boxes joined by a bench top — quick enough to build, prime, and paint in an afternoon.
| Part | Qty | T × W × L | Material | ✓ |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Cabinet sides | 4 | 3/4" × 11 1/4" × 10" | 1x12 | ☐ |
| Cabinet tops | 2 | 3/4" × 11 1/4" × 11 1/2" | 1x12 | ☐ |
| Cabinet shelves | 4 | 3/4" × 11 1/4" × 19 3/4" | 1x12 | ☐ |
| Front base molding | 2 | 3/4" × 3 1/4" × 11 1/2" | base molding | ☐ |
| Bench top | 1 | 3/4" × 11 1/4" × 16 1/2" | 1x12 | ☐ |
| Front trim molding (long) | 1 | 3/4" × 1 1/2" × 18" | 1-1/2 in molding | ☐ |
| Front trim molding (short) | 2 | 3/4" × 1 1/2" × 11 1/2" | 1-1/2 in molding | ☐ |
| Bench cleats | 2 | 3/4" × 1 1/2" × 11 1/2" | 1x2 | ☐ |
| Item | Qty | ✓ |
|---|---|---|
| 1x12, 8 ft Both cabinet boxes and the bench top. | 2 each | ☐ |
| Base molding, 3-1/4 in (24 in) Buy a short length at the home center. | 1 each | ☐ |
| Molding, 1-1/2 in (48 in) Front trim. | 1 each | ☐ |
| 1x2 (24 in) Bench-top cleats. | 1 each | ☐ |
| Plywood or beadboard, 1/4 in (scraps) Backs, at least 11-1/2" x 20-1/2". | 1 each | ☐ |
| Wood screws, 2 in | 1 box | ☐ |
| Wood screws, 1-1/4 in | 1 box | ☐ |
| Finish nails, 1-1/4 in | 1 box | ☐ |
| Wood glue and filler | 1 each | ☐ |
| Primer and child-safe paint | 1 quart | ☐ |
